Commit Graph

324 Commits (main-multiple-administrations-#186762859)

Author SHA1 Message Date
Nelson Jovel d2c2eb8994 Refactored guage graph and presenter to make variable names clearer
4 years ago
Nelson Jovel 03a63cb568 Add zone boundary legends to gauge graph.
4 years ago
Nelson Jovel ad03606d66 Add benchmarks to survey and admin data items. Remove them from measures. Modify seeder
4 years ago
Nelson Jovel 1a6c81e240 remove fontawesome symlinked directory from public folder
4 years ago
Nelson Jovel 8bebf106e6 Merge branch 'dev-design'
4 years ago
Nelson Jovel 6931428d8f Make measure name responsive
4 years ago
Nelson Jovel eb4c699f60 Modifies the overview page so when there is an empty dataset, there is clearer explanatory text and an empty version of the variance chart. Finishes #180118088
4 years ago
Nelson Jovel f553c3c11c Rename 'Dashboard' to overview in page text and also modify 'dashboard' routes to be 'overview'. Finishes #180076071
4 years ago
Nelson Jovel 2753888f11 Add category, subcategory and measure ids to the page. Finishes #179986325
4 years ago
Nelson Jovel cacc853518 Adds category short description to database and renders descriptions in
4 years ago
Nelson Jovel bde992c96b Finishes #180264854. Prevents empty dataset modal from displaying on browse page
4 years ago
Liam Morley b45dca7a5a Remove text regarding school years from empty dataset modal
4 years ago
Liam Morley 0af26e25f2 Display gauges with no benchmarks as "Insufficient Data" with no key benchmark indicator
4 years ago
Nelson Jovel aeb6a45a45 Show partial data indicators on variance chart
4 years ago
Liam Morley eff22d2ac8 Report that admin data is not included
4 years ago
Liam Morley 6aa9f00adc Revert "Tie legacy analytics ID to environment"
4 years ago
Liam Morley 557109662c Move legacy layouts into a legacy folder
4 years ago
Liam Morley aa4ce86eaa Show icon/explanation in measure accordion when a section has insufficient data
4 years ago
Liam Morley f81874d082 Externalize Hotjar tracking code to an environment variable
4 years ago
Liam Morley f6e6fb2b2d Add Hotjar tracking code to home and dashboard/browse layouts
4 years ago
Liam Morley ce892161a4 Remove type from script element
4 years ago
Liam Morley 3e15194eff Tie legacy analytics ID to environment
4 years ago
Liam Morley 48f2d64c71 Extract Google Analytics ID out to an environment variable
4 years ago
Liam Morley 293de8698f Restore white half of 'watch' harvey ball
4 years ago
rebuilt 221f0cb0bf Replace harvey balls with new SVGs
4 years ago
Liam Morley 1be86721b0 Always reference fully-qualified School/District/Category in controllers
4 years ago
Liam Morley 413096dfe2 Extract legacy parts of the codebase into its own module
4 years ago
Liam Morley cf6e80ce6b Show modal when no measures for a school/year have meet their threshold
4 years ago
rebuilt 856cce7c1a Style accordions
4 years ago
rebuilt 13469f60bd Add styling changes. Change focus state color for select elements. Change wording of about MCIEA section
4 years ago
rebuilt 722947d938 When there is insufficient data to display gauge graph, change title of
4 years ago
rebuilt d850674ff1 Style focus states, margin for logo, popover borders, accordions
4 years ago
Alex Basson 228cf137ad Finishes #179904795. Adds prompts to measures section on browse page
4 years ago
Liam Morley 2a9810f7db Pair with design on styling
4 years ago
Liam Morley ad7dd85524 Refactor variance chart to make view responsible for sorting measures
4 years ago
Liam Morley 4fafe2cb50 Display popover on harvey balls not in a zone
4 years ago
Liam Morley 00a0e5868c Specify harvey ball state classes as BEM modifier, not element
4 years ago
Liam Morley dfc49d109a Display harvey balls with white backgrounds and display no-zone harvey balls
4 years ago
Alex Basson dc0139d5c5 Small design cleanup on welcome page
4 years ago
rebuilt 9e9663a1dd Add footer to all pages. Finishes #179844107
4 years ago
Liam Morley 4278021c2d Finish styling for homepage
4 years ago
Liam Morley f3a86c6145 Add cateory icon to home page
4 years ago
rebuilt bd8e17b749 Link logo to /welcome page. Correct background color of tabs. Create 'caption' css class
4 years ago
Liam Morley 332043c6fb Use CategoryPresenter in welcome page instead of SqmCategory
4 years ago
rebuilt 4306f5c5d4 Update landing page to include accordion and footer
4 years ago
Alex Basson 161db3bf3e Display in the variance graph only those measures that have sufficient data
4 years ago
Alex Basson 10e70557bd Display insufficient data note. TODO: remove measures from variance chart
4 years ago
rebuilt c423fcc014 Change implementation of div pointer.
4 years ago
Alex Basson 28f32d072f Create landing page to select a school dashboard [179826663]
4 years ago
Liam Morley 31a9f3f0a4 Adjust dashboard layout as per dev/design story
4 years ago
Liam Morley f9492f0c76 Adjust header form selects to only take as much space as they require
4 years ago
rebuilt baec96e7d1 Style _gauge_graph
4 years ago
rebuilt 382f20fcfa Set default base font to Cabin. Add styling to header.
4 years ago
Alex Basson 8f9d30a762 SQM Indicators View Details button sends user to browse page [Finishes #179728459]
4 years ago
Alex Basson 0d9474f2c0 Add harvey ball legend to sqm indicators card
4 years ago
Alex Basson b1c7ba3f0f Update the color palate; move harvey ball indicators above variance graph
4 years ago
rebuilt ae2b88592a Generate binstubs for rspec
4 years ago
rebuilt 6320d5633f Add JS tests to verify school and district dropdowns.
4 years ago
Alex Basson bb8d80856d Refactor nav tabs css
4 years ago
Liam Morley 193b7bd792 Update logo
4 years ago
Liam Morley a406205e20 Completes Sub Categories and Measures for "All " Category Tabs -
4 years ago
Chad Serrant 5595af15b6 Harvey balls depicting how a sub-category is performing quickly [179843984]
4 years ago
Liam Morley 4aa0c97275 Rename browse controller to sqm categories controller
4 years ago
Chad Serrant ae525fdb2a Completes Measures on the "Teachers & Leadership" Category Tab -
4 years ago
rebuilt bb1f6aa972 Complete styling for _quality_framework_indicators
4 years ago
rebuilt 9e047f9aea Finish styling quality framework indicators
4 years ago
Liam Morley 291dd6d422 Style Category cards
4 years ago
rebuilt b29107688e Use category presenters on page.
4 years ago
Alex Basson 000bb52e1d Display subcategory descriptions on browse page
4 years ago
Alex Basson 8cc6866c61 Style dashboard page
4 years ago
Alex Basson 45c5392b2e Style header links to be heavier when active
4 years ago
Alex Basson f8166aed47 Simplify js by including full path in district and school options values
4 years ago
Alex Basson 4d6eb4ecf1 Remove unnecessary flex scss file; make header go edge-to-edge
4 years ago
Alex Basson 504bf8bc57 Move dropdowns into header view
4 years ago
Alex Basson 15ecf1db0d Extract view helper for variance graph
4 years ago
Alex Basson 5c352671da Update to Bootstrap 5, basic styling
4 years ago
Alex Basson 516701332d Use sqm_application.html.erb layout and sqm_application.scss for new pages
4 years ago
Alex Basson 03a52161a6 Extract view helpers for gauge graph
4 years ago
Liam Morley 25578a896f we have a gauge! next up, let's style the page
4 years ago
rebuilt cc2f3f9352 Expand the Measured Dashboard to All Schools and Districts. [Finishes #179727798]
4 years ago
rebuilt d7ead5bac9 Show all Measure Scores [finishes #179707160]
4 years ago
Alex Basson 587cbbdd3d Add typography and color styles
4 years ago
Alex Basson 6814e213c7 Format measure graph partial
4 years ago
rebuilt 7c979ff01c Add benchmark label and inset shadows to graph
4 years ago
Alex Basson dc9c10b58f Use bootstrap to style dashboard
4 years ago
Alex Basson 12415861c1 Rename construct -> measure, seed with SqmCategories and Subcategories
4 years ago
Alex Basson 1ad12c1bfe Add spacing css
4 years ago
Alex Basson 643ee8d3a7 Extract bar graph partial
4 years ago
rebuilt 71ad999dd0 Add slug to district
4 years ago
Alex Basson 886f94a60c Display pre-selected dropdowns on dashboard graph
4 years ago
Alex Basson 810a702333 Refactor construct_graph_row_presenter to return negative values for x-offset and extract percentage method
4 years ago
Alex Basson 8915cb9d45 Add Item, seed from .csv file
4 years ago
Alex Basson acac8f67b0 Seed db with Professional Qualifications construct
4 years ago
Alex Basson c5bd1a9b3f Create construct graph svg with hard-coded parameters
4 years ago
Alex Basson d25c9567cf Remove vestigial experiments endpoint
4 years ago
Alex Basson 813efca493 Visiting /districts/winchester/schools/winchester-high-school/dashboard displays an empty dashboard
4 years ago
Alex Basson 48a6dfac57 REVERT ME: Add /experiments route
4 years ago
Jared Cosulich 689fe56dd5 reverse years order
6 years ago
Jared Cosulich d240e8cdc2 inline list of years
6 years ago
Jared Cosulich 6c626be9c5 don't show certain schools
6 years ago
Jared Cosulich adc8c96b1b sorting categories on boston pages
6 years ago
Jared Cosulich 1cda8fd294 don't fail if aggregated responses are missing
6 years ago
Jared Cosulich 7fb5bfd242 don't fail if info is nil
6 years ago
Jared Cosulich 65bce3b299 sort school categories by root category for Boston
7 years ago
Jared Cosulich 9c556ec8a3 sort school categories by root category for Boston
7 years ago
Jared Cosulich ec5367eb67 removing breadcrumbs from Boston
7 years ago
Jared Cosulich 8d9d42dce8 remove raise
7 years ago
Jared Cosulich 5f5ac0289f dont show the effective leadership scale questions
7 years ago
Jared Cosulich 07d3175761 new boston view
7 years ago
Jared Cosulich f4542c7a20 secret param to see possible attempts
7 years ago
Jared Cosulich bf5e4f3d8f dont show admin data for boston schools
7 years ago
Jared Cosulich c130fd7ff8 show all questions
7 years ago
Jared Cosulich fa80643770 always show all categories
7 years ago
Jared Cosulich 76f6e1d1fa adding google analytics tracking code
7 years ago
Jared Cosulich 50930ecc62 show admin data on admin categories
7 years ago
Jared Cosulich ef3d0186a5 propogate up valid_child_count for admin data
7 years ago
Jared Cosulich 7bfbe1a94c faq, 2018 nonlikert values
7 years ago
Jared Cosulich 0b7beee9bf tweaking styles
7 years ago
Jared Cosulich 4241f3f7df tweaking styles
7 years ago
Jared Cosulich 67e7fea2a0 hide question partial debug info
7 years ago
Jared Cosulich 93485bd886 tweaking question partial
7 years ago
Jared Cosulich 3531cafa33 show source of question
7 years ago
Jared Cosulich a82deaafd8 adding response_total to SchoolQuestion
7 years ago
Jared Cosulich 341c561a67 fixing bug with other districts
7 years ago
Jared Cosulich 1b06552edd fully hiding insufficient data in Boston
7 years ago
Jared Cosulich 50b97498fd don't show measures if not enough valid_child_count
7 years ago
Jared Cosulich 3420cc8f5d improving copy
7 years ago
Jared Cosulich 0f345a3bdd show valid child count on child school categories
7 years ago
Jared Cosulich 068867dfa3 show valid child count on child school categories
7 years ago
Jared Cosulich 1bfa3651a9 tweaking percentage display
7 years ago
Jared Cosulich 3c35103fed tweaking styles
7 years ago
Jared Cosulich b4fdffe0dd fixing bug
7 years ago
Jared Cosulich 9f659537dc fixing haml bug
7 years ago
Jared Cosulich 4ad2660e28 using valid_child_count
7 years ago
Jared Cosulich fd9d2f4a13 new response rate thresholds
7 years ago
Jared Cosulich d9b7fd89f2 normalized question text
7 years ago
Jared Cosulich e39e32f700 fixing school category order
7 years ago
Jared Cosulich fcf15e9c2f fixing school category order
7 years ago
Jared Cosulich 76bdb86211 fixing bugs
7 years ago
Jared Cosulich 2ddbb55a26 fixing years on school page
7 years ago
Jared Cosulich b5f950c7bd showing year data on school page
7 years ago
Jared Cosulich 46bf9fc754 tweaking copy
7 years ago
Jared Cosulich 000990e865 tweaking copy
7 years ago
Jared Cosulich a4b005d83b tweaking copy
7 years ago
Jared Cosulich 1ee9df7695 better years links
7 years ago
Jared Cosulich 5cecfc8374 linking between years
7 years ago
Jared Cosulich 3d238df1c7 show accurate year
7 years ago
Jared Cosulich 8a43bdeeba error message for insufficient data
8 years ago
Jared Cosulich f47181d374 error message for insufficient data
8 years ago
Jared Cosulich 20b04ea202 error message for insufficient data
8 years ago